Borbon accident: 2 construction workers electrocuted, suffer 3rd degree burns

Victims were installing a gutter on a roof which accidentally touched a high-voltage wire

CEBU CITY, Philippines — Two construction workers suffered third degree burns in their bodies after they were electrocuted when the gutter of the roof that they were working on touched a high voltage wire.

The accident happened at past 3 p.m. on Tuesday, October 17, in Sitio Galaban. Barangay Poblacion, Borbon town in northern Cebu.

Borbon accident victims

Authorities identified the victims as 33-year-old Enucincio Cañete, and 20-year-old Christian Presillas.

Both victims are from Barangay Muabog, Tabogon town in northern Cebu.

Initial investigation showed that the victims, who were construction workers, were installing a gutter on the roof of the structure, when the gutter they both were holding accidentally touched a high-voltage wire, causing them to fall to the ground.

Borbon accident victims’ injuries

Both victims suffered injuries and were brought to the Sogod District Hospital for treatment.  

Authorities said that the attending physician, Dr. Jojie Padilla diagnosed the victims as suffering from acute septic shock secondary to electrocution with third degree burns on their bodies.

Transfer to Cebu City hospital

Padilla advised the victims to be transferred to a Cebu City hospital for further treatment.

Borbon town is a fourth class municipality of the province of Cebu, which is situated approximately 80 kilometers northeast of Cebu City.
